ASHFOOD! Festival is BACK with a Bigger, Bolder, and More Flavourful Line-Up!
ASHFOOD! Festival is back for 2025, ready to turn up the heat with even more exciting offerings! Returning for the third consecutive year, but this time for just one day on Saturday, June 28th, as part of the Ashford Food & Drink Festival taking place in Ashford’s town centre, the festival promises to be bigger, bolder, and packed with even more delicious local delights and entertainment.
Sponsored by Girlings, locally recognised solicitors, the festival, held at the vibrant Elwick Place, promises to be a feast for the senses, featuring an incredible lineup of local food, drinks, entertainment, and family-friendly fun.
Prepare for a taste explosion as local and regional vendors bring their best to the table. Sip on handcrafted cocktails by Lexi from Hide Bar, a World Margarita finalist, and sample wines from Kent’s Wine Garden of England. Indulge in the bold flavours of Lilia’s Kitchen, offering the true taste of Madagascar, or pick up something sweet from local sensations Simply Ice Cream. Caffeine and Fizz’s iconic pink coffee truck will also make a return, keeping the crowds caffeinated and refreshed!
Elwick Place’s own food and drink establishments will also join in the festivities, offering treats and exclusive offers from The Ashford Cinema and Matches Sports Bar.
This year’s festival takes the entertainment up a notch, with live music, performances, and interactive activities throughout the day for both children and adults. The stage will come alive with a dynamic mix of local musicians, DJs, and performances. Local favourites, including The Upsetters, the three-piece acoustic band, will perform, while exciting new acts such as country sensation Tom Wilson will serenade the crowds and the incredible DJ JG will return to keep the energy high with chart-topping hits!
ASHFOOD! is all about fun for the whole family! Kids will enjoy free crafts, face painting, and interactive activities. Just a short five-minute walk from Ashford International Station, festival-goers can hop off the train and dive straight into a day of food, fun, and festivities.
